Symrise's Annual Report: A Crucial Test for Investor Confidence
04.03.2026 - 04:36:48 | boerse-global.deToday's release of Symrise's full-year 2025 financial and business report provides the definitive data investors have been awaiting, especially following a period of subdued growth. The market's scrutiny will extend beyond the headline revenue, earnings, and margin figures. A central question looms: do the results validate the company's new capital return narrative, anchored by its inaugural share buyback program? This is where analyst focus is likely to be most intense.
The share price closed yesterday at €73.76. Despite this level, the stock remains down 24.5% over a 12-month period, trading approximately 31% below its 52-week high. A near-term Relative Strength Index (RSI) reading of 27.5 further underscores a technical picture that suggests the equity is deeply oversold.
The Annual Figures in Detail
While Symrise offered preliminary insights throughout the year, the complete 2025 results set the official benchmark. The context behind the numbers is paramount. Investors will assess the resilience of the business model within what the company termed an "economically challenging environment" and gauge the true state of its profitability.
Segment performance commands particular attention. In the third quarter of 2025, Symrise reported organic sales growth of 1.4% and subsequently adjusted its full-year outlook. Its Scent & Care division notably underperformed expectations during that period. The annual report will now reveal whether this segmental weakness persisted through the fourth quarter or if management succeeded in stabilizing its performance.
Strategic Moves Set the Stage for 2026
Symrise entered the new fiscal year with two significant strategic developments. In January, the management board announced the first share repurchase program in the company's history, authorizing up to €400 million to buy back its own shares between February 2025 and October 2026. The decision was justified by the firm's robust free cash flow generation.

A further source of market uncertainty was removed in February. The U.S. Department of Justice concluded a competition law investigation without finding evidence of unlawful practices. Together, the buyback initiative and the resolved DoJ probe form the critical backdrop against which the 2025 financials will be judged.
Technical and Fundamental Crossroads
From a chart perspective, the technical signals are mixed. Although the closing price sits marginally above the 50-day moving average (€72.90), it remains about 5.5% below the 200-day moving average (€78.06). This aligns with the broader narrative: signs of short-term stabilization are present, but the longer-term bullish trend has not yet been reclaimed.
The full disclosure of 2025's revenue, earnings trajectory, and annual profitability will provide concrete evidence today. Ultimately, these operational results will determine whether the announced share repurchase is perceived as a confident deployment of strong cash flow, or if the market requires more convincing fundamental performance before regaining confidence.
